4. PRODUCTION PROCESS
• Beyond: Two Souls was created by a French game developer
Quantic Dream and then it got published by Sony Computer
Entertainment.
• It was released in October of 2013. Beyond: Two Souls was motion
captured throughout the whole thing to make sure its more of a fluid
animation. Quantic Dream is a medium sized company that has
made games like heavy rain.
• It would of took around about 9 months for the filming crew to finish
filming the motion capture. This shows us they had to make sure
that everything was perfect. They done the motion capture by
putting on special equipment and using cardboard when recording
for example if they were eating a pizza in game, the actor would
have to fake eating cardboard.

5. CHARACTERS
There are many characters in Beyond: Two souls but the main
ones are:
Jodie (Ellen Page) – Jodie is a young girl who lives on a military
base with her foster parents. Since she was born she’s had a
psychic connect with a mysterious entity named Aiden.
Nathan Dawkins (Willem Dafoe) – Nathan Dawkins is a doctor
who is looking after Jodie because she go into a incident where
she nearly killed one of the neighborhood kids which made
Jodie’s foster parents seek for help to make sure Jodie’s
condition gets taking care of.
Ryan Clayton (Eric Winter) – Ryan Clayton is a CIA agent who
gets sent to forcibly recruit Jodie. When Jodie grew up she
worked besides Ryan throughout all of her missions.
The characters in game look photo-realistic to the actors that
got motion captured throughout the whole game.

PlayStation 3 :
CPU : 3.2 GHz Cell Broadband Engine.
Memory : 256 MB system and 256 MB video.
Graphics : 500 MHz NVIDIA/SCEI.
Operating system : PlayStation 3 system software.

15. DONKEY KONG - PLATFORMS
• There is many platforms this game is on. The original platform this
game was on was the Arcade machine. It was firstly released on 1981.
Then it moved onto Nintendo Entertainment systems, Wii, Game boys
etc.
• Donkey Kong is a single player game.
Donkey Kong arcade machine :
CPU : Z80 @ 3.072 MHz
Sound : DAC @ 400 kHz
Display : Raster monitor 224x256 resolution.
